All You Need To Know About Box Truck Rigs

There are many companies that provide for quality box trucks. They are constructed with strict guidelines load distribution which is ready-to-use. Every single Box Truck Rigs are calculated on their axel strength, tongue weight, the location of materials and spray foam machinery for the right balance and transportation security and safety.

  • The spray foam rigs are designed in such a manner that they can perform in any given weather condition. They can survive humidity, dry heat, extreme freezing cold, basically, they can function in any type of weather condition.
  • A closed cell spray foam is put from the very top to the very bottom of the truck. There are lighting and chrome put in the interior for more visibility. There is also rooftop ventilation, a workstation place, electrical outlets and hydraulic machines that ensure swift and smooth processing.
  • Spray foam equipment is included that lasts a very long time if properly maintained. It also includes- heated hoses, PMC spray guns, high pressure, drum heaters, spray foam systems, and transfer pumps.
  • Each of the Box Truck Rigs is built with tool boxes and shelves/cabinets that allows one to keep valuable tools. It is like a storage space!
  • Also, barrel racks are mounted to ensure safety and security of products and foam materials during transfer from job to job.
  • There are hinged hose hangers available that allow quick job setups and EOD (end of the day) wrap-ups. To avoid moisture in the containment, an air dry and air regulator, a moisture trap and oil separator system is installed.
  • There are storage pump tubes that are also placed to protect barrel pumps during transfers and protect the pumps when they are not being used.
  • To ensure the right compliance with the OSHA standards, a personal protective equipment better known by its abbreviation PPE, safety equipment and supplies are also added.
  • Additionally, Box Truck Rigs have a ramp door, side access door, and hose door that helps to easily access different parts of the foam rig while in use and at the same time keeps it very secure.
  • There is an industrial moisture resistant 1,500 psi fluid lines and industrial 200 psi airlines that helps prevent material waste.
  • Drum Dolly, spare parts, gun cleaner, and pump lube are among the other spray foam accessories included.
